Dog anemia is mainly due to hemorrhagic anemia

Anemia can occur due to heavy bleeding caused by trauma or surgery, blood draw caused by parvovirus or acute gastroenteritis.

Dog anemia is mainly due to hemolytic anemia

Anemia caused by massive destruction of red blood cells due to various reasons is called hemolytic anemia. Such as Babesia infection caused by tick bites; hemolytic anemia caused by breastfeeding due to different blood types between puppies and bitches; caused by infectious diseases; such as leptospirosis, herpes pathogens, trypanosomatids, and hemolytic streptococci Infection etc.

Dog anemia is mainly due to nutritional anemia

Nutritional anemia: refers to the lack of certain hematopoietic substances, which affects the production of red blood cells and hemoglobin and causes nutritional anemia. This is common in puppies, such as insufficient food intake and nutritionally unbalanced food.

The causes of anemia in dogs are different

There is not a single type of anemia. There are many causes of anemia in dogs. Therefore, if you want to improve the anemia in dogs, you must first understand What kind of anemia does the dog have? Only in this way can we prescribe the right medicine and find a better treatment method.
